Tvl.Sri Meenakshi Pharma, v. The Commercial Tax Officer
BEFORE THE MADURAI BENCH OF MADRAS HIGH COURT DATED : 07.09.2017 CORAM :
THE HONOURABLE MR.JUSTICE T.RAJA W.P.(MD)Nos.16931 to 16933 of 2017 and WMP Nos. 13512, 13513 and 13519 of 2017 Tvl. Sri Meenakshi Pharma Represented by its Partner S.Muthiah ... Petitioner in all Writ Petitions Vs.
The Commercial Tax Officer, Thanjavur II Assessment Circle Thanjavur ... Respondent in all Writ petitions COMMON PRAYER: Writ Petitions filed under Article 226 of the Constitution of India, praying for issuance of a Writs of Certiorari to call for the records of the respondent in TIN/33413823218/2011-12, 2013-14 and 2012-13 respectively and dated 31.01.2017 and quash the same as arbitrary, illegal. For Petitioner : Mr.D.Venkatesh For Respondents : Mr.R.Karthikeyan Additional Government Pleader COMMON ORDER By consent of both sides, this writ petitions themselves are taken up for final disposal.
2. Heard the learned counsel for the petitioner and the learned Additional Government Pleader.
3.These writ petitions are directed against the impugned order dated 31.01.2017 and however, the petitioner has challenged the same before this Court, belatedly, after a lapse of eight months. https://hcservices.ecourts.gov.in/hcservices/
Therefore, this Court is not inclined to entertain these writ petitions. Accordingly, the writ petitions are dismissed. No costs. Consequently connected Miscellaneous Petitions are closed.
